LIGHTMAN 1981
One of my alltime favourite holograms. It explodes with light and colour. Harris was using a Russian development process at the time with very distinctive results.
Reflection hologram,
Glass 8x10

HENRY MOORE - MOTHER & CHILD 1982
Reflection hologram.
Glass 8' x 10'
Gift of K.H.
Harris did not market this image due to copyright problems but it is a good example of using holography as an alternative means of reproducing a sculpture.
